In a blast furnace, a substance called coke (mainly C) reacts with oxygen, , to form carbon monoxide, . The carbon monoxide (a strong reducing agent) then reacts with iron oxide (in the form of hematite or magnetite) to form pig iron (mainly Fe) and carbon dioxide.
